Melvin Victor Samuelson was born Apr. 30, 1921 to Carl Victor and Minnie Malinda Hackerson Samuelson. He died May 19, 2015 and is buried in Fairfield Cemetery, Albert City, IA.

Melvin served with the U.S. Navy in World War II.

Russell E. Sandstedt was born Mar. 18, 1903 to Anders Gustaf and Wilhelmina Sandstedt. He died Apr. 29, 1973.

Russell served with the U.S. Army in World War II.

Charles John Sassman was born May 2, 1907 to Charles and Gertrude Sassman. He died Feb. 2, 1947 and is buried in Marathon, IA.

Charles served in World War II with the U.S. Army.

Theodore Benjamin and Meta Behrens Satory Family:

Reynard Marion ”Rey” Satory was born Mar. 6, 1926 to Theodore Benjamin and Meta Behrens Satory. He died July 31, 2017 and is buried in Saint Albans Episcopal Church Columbarium, Spirit Lake, IA.

Rey served in World War II with the U.S. Navy aboard the USS Arenac (APA-128).

Rodney J. Satory was born Jan. 4, 1925 to Theodore Benjamin and Meta Behrens Satory. He died Sept. 18, 2005.

Rodney served with the U.S. Navy in World War II.

Roger Stanley Satory was born Sept. 17, 1922 to Theodore Benjamin and Meta Behrens Satory. He died Apr. 10, 1986 and is buried in Masonic Cemetery, Des Moines, IA.

Sgt. Satory served with the U.S. Army in World War II.
